This is a project I started some time ago during the Meshmixer learning process. It was mixed out of several of Devon Jones' Openforge pieces. The project was soon scrapped due to the huge amount of printing time it will take to create. However, recently it was requested in one of the groups so here it is. I have not printed it and it may be months before I do, so if anyone wants to be the first, be sure to share your pictures.

Parts 1-4 glue together
Parts 5-7 glue together
parts 8-11 glue together
parts 12-14 glue together
parts 15-18 glue together
After these 5 components are made, they should slide together easily for use and disassemble easily for storage.
